Map View

SurveyMini App

Want to write your own reviews?

Download our SurveyMini App.

For Apple For Android

Carter Museum Locations

Carter-Museum-Fort-Worth-TX

Carter Museum

3501 Camp Bowie Blvd, Fort Worth, TX  |  Museums

21 Reviews